Had this after a day of skiing at Mt. Rose at the Pinon Bottle Shop/Bar in Sparks right when they opened. Had the place to myself, bartender seemed cool. Beer hit the spot. Just added the beer to the database, and I'm gonna write a review because I'm not some total sociopath who just adds the beer but doesn't write a review.
Pours yellow, no surprises in pilsner land so far. 1/2" white head on top of a beer w decent clarity. The aroma was yielding a lager yeast, but also the Moteuka hop, which might be off the beaten path pilsner wise, but works better in execution that it does on paper.
Taste reveals this to almost be an IPL. The hopping is a line stepper. But its done well, and I liked it. You get a good mixture of lager yeast, pilsner malt and Moteuka hops. Not really sure about that commercial tug job regarding it tasting like "lime" but no biggie, I still liked it.
Alibi does good stuff, this is no exception. I should prolly buy their packaged beer more often instead of mostly just having their stuff when I'm in Reno beer bars.
